Output 25044ec4718a6b569c0490998b0d049edcbe0a2e4f2ea9a2fd5c72d154f206c8:1

value
62742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84db5fa65893eda59232d9e855e7874f68bee926 OP_EQUAL
address
3DoVvDHDzej9uHNeVdjcAJpShvVFvV2LfH
transaction
25044ec4718a6b569c0490998b0d049edcbe0a2e4f2ea9a2fd5c72d154f206c8
spent
true